The Material characterization and kinetic parameters based Thermoluminescence (TL) study of virgin and heat treated Pakistani Onyx marble is reported. Pellets of mineral under various heat treatments named as virgin (S1), pre-heated (S2), annealed (S3), heat-treated-slowly-cooled (S4), are prepared. Material characterization is performed using TGA, XRD, SEM-EDX, and ICP-OES techniques. ICP & EDXs shows C, O, Ca as major elements and Al, Mn, Mg, Fe, Si as impurity content. Crystalline nature under heat treatment remains unaffected up to 773 K as indicated by the XRD analysis. TGA shows sample is CaCO3 with no mass loss from 303 to 893 K. XRD and TGA analysis concludes that TL analysis is possible within 303-673 K. After 03 Gy of beta-irradiaton dose, the TL responses are investigated. All samples show a thermally stable peak around 552 +/- 3 K. The kinetic features responsible for TL response are studied using Initial rise (IR) method, Chen Peak Shapes (CPS) analysis and P.N. Keating technique. Kinetic order values vary within 1.75-1.05. The activation energy ranges from 0.88 to 1.33 eV, frequency factor appears within 106-1010 s-1. Calculated parameters are validated by comparing MATLAB generated synthetic curves with experimental results. CPS and IR based synthetic curves are in good agreement with the experimental curves. Heat treated Sample S4 shows enhanced TL response as compared to other samples.
